Banana and Chocolate Chip Oat Bars

Banana bread meets peanut butter cup in a protein bar that holds together for lunchboxes, desk drawers and post-gym raids. Each bar brings 10.7g of protein, melty dark chocolate and real mashed banana.

Serves: 12

Macros

257 Calories
10.7 Protein
28 Carbs
12.3 Fat

How to Make Banana and Chocolate Chip Oat Bars

  • Ingredients

    • 3 ripe bananas, mashed
    • 2 large eggs
    • ⅓ cup milk
    • ½ cup smooth peanut butter
    • 2 tbsp grapeseed oil
    • ⅓ cup brown sugar
    • 1 cup self-raising plain flour
    • 60g True Protein WPI 90 in French Vanilla
    • 1 cup rolled oats
    • 160g dark chocolate chips
  • Instructions

    1. Preheat the oven to 180°C fan-forced and line a 20 × 20 cm baking dish with baking paper.
    2. In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, peanut butter, grapeseed oil and brown sugar. Stir in the mashed bananas.
    3. In a separate bowl, combine the flour, protein powder and rolled oats.
    4.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ix until just combined. Fold through the dark chocolate chips.
    5. Pour the mixture into the prepared tin and spread evenly.
    6.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, or until a skewer inserted into the centre comes out clean.
    7. Allow to cool completely before slicing into 12 bars.

    True tip: prepare these for meal prep and toast it in the sandwich press to serve with greek yoghurt.
